ALMOST!
I can't even use the thumbs to rate - you have a good and bad example of each category within your design:.
-Get rid of one of the diamonds (and the diamond over the "i"- use a dot)
-Get rid of one of the colors (preferably light gray)
-Get rid of one of the fonts (if you don't use a space between words, differentiate with a bold of the same font, not a different uncomplimentary font)
OK, I think I covered it all. Basically simplify this and you'll be in a good spot.
